In the first episode of Season 2 of the "Lucky 13 Podcast," hosts Mike Lantz and Josh Hauser discuss decision-making strategies within organizations. They emphasize the importance of core values and focus, sharing insights from books they've read. The episode introduces frameworks like RACI to clarify roles and responsibilities and a quadrant system to categorize decisions based on urgency and importance. They stress the need for leaders to empower their teams, delegate effectively, and create a culture of accountability. Personal reflections on decision-making in both professional and personal contexts round out the episode, offering listeners practical advice for effective leadership.
